Question
f(x)= 35, 1<=x<=5
30, 6<=x<=10
25, x>=11
Grace and her family are going to an amusement park How much will it cost for 5 tickets

To determine the cost for 5 tickets based on the given piecewise function \( f(x) \), we need to first identify the appropriate cost per ticket based on the range of \( x \).
Since Grace and her family are buying 5 tickets, we need to see where this falls under the defined ranges:
- For \( 1 \leq x \leq 5 \), the cost per ticket is \( 35 \).
- For \( 6 \leq x \leq 10 \), the cost per ticket is \( 30 \).
- For \( x \geq 11 \), the cost per ticket is \( 25 \).
Since \( 5 \) (the number of tickets) falls within the first range (\( 1 \leq x \leq 5 \)), the cost for one ticket is \( 35 \).
Now, calculate the total cost for 5 tickets:
\[
\text{Total Cost} = \text{Number of Tickets} \times \text{Cost per Ticket}
\]
\[
\text{Total Cost} = 5 \times 35 = 175
\]
Therefore, the total cost for 5 tickets will be **$175**.
